Polkadot Price Hits Critical Support at $0.74
Polkadot's price has been steadily declining and is now trading at $0.76, with every major moving average stacked above it like a wall of resistance.
The 200-day SMA sits at $1.17, meaning DOT is trading 35% below its long-run average, which indicates a trend rather than a correction.
Despite some bullish signals from the derivatives market, where top traders are positioned 69.5% long against 30.5% short, there are also signs of caution, including a lack of conviction and a risk-reward profile that is not favorable for active traders.
The $0.74 level is seen as a critical support level, with a break below it potentially triggering stop-loss cascades and sending the price to sub-$0.70 levels.
